43 changes: 43 additions & 0 deletions isogeny/examples/csidh.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,43 @@
use curve::Curve;
use isogeny::csidh;
use rand::{RngExt, rng};

const KEY_BOUND: usize = 74;

fn random_private_key<R: RngExt>(rng: &mut R) -> [i8; csidh::PRIMES.len()] {
let mut key = [0i8; csidh::PRIMES.len()];
for slot in key.iter_mut().take(KEY_BOUND) {
*slot = (rng.random::<u8>() % 3) as i8 - 1;
}
key
}

fn main() {
let mut rng = rng();
let a_priv = random_private_key(&mut rng);
let b_priv = random_private_key(&mut rng);
let ells: Vec<u64> = csidh::PRIMES.iter().take(KEY_BOUND).copied().collect();
println!("Small primes in play: {:?}", ells);
println!("Alice's private: {:?}", &a_priv[..KEY_BOUND]);
println!("Bob's private: {:?}", &b_priv[..KEY_BOUND]);

let start = csidh::base_curve();

println!("\nDeriving public curves...");
let t = std::time::Instant::now();
let a_pub = csidh::action(&start, &a_priv, &mut || rng.random::<u64>());
let b_pub = csidh::action(&start, &b_priv, &mut || rng.random::<u64>());
println!("done in {:?}", t.elapsed());

println!("\nDeriving shared secrets...");
let t = std::time::Instant::now();
let a_shared = csidh::action(&b_pub, &a_priv, &mut || rng.random::<u64>());
let b_shared = csidh::action(&a_pub, &b_priv, &mut || rng.random::<u64>());
println!("done in {:?}", t.elapsed());

let j_a = a_shared.j_invariant();
let j_b = b_shared.j_invariant();
assert_eq!(j_a, j_b, "shared j-invariants disagreed");
println!("\nShared j-invariant: {:?}", j_a);
println!("CSIDH shared secret established.");
}
